262. How Centering Lived Experience is Transforming the Child Welfare System - Sixto Cancel
Meet Sixto. He's been advocating for change at the intersection of child welfare and advanced technology since the age of 16. His lived experience in foster care fuels his passion for shifting system policy and practice through the use of technology, data & unyielding compassion. This Founder and CEO of Think of Us is directing this progressive nonprofit to end institutional placements and reform our foster care system by listening, gathering & activating.
261. Solving the Leadership Crisis + The Mission of Global Citizen Year - Abby Falik
Meet Abby. She’s a social entrepreneur and founder of Global Citizen Year, an organization reimagining the transition into adulthood by facilitating a yearlong immersion experience abroad for high school graduates. By equipping young leaders with empathy, agency & a global perspective, they’re changing the inputs into higher education in order to dramatically improve the outcomes of the world. 256. Meet the Fashion E-Commerce Startup Fueling a Charitable Impact - Jeannie Barsam
Meet Jeannie. She left the corporate world after leading Fortune 500 retailers including Gap Inc, Michaels, Talbot's, and Signet Jewelers to create a business that was more than just fast fashion. Gifting Brands was born out of a passion for helping women, children, and families in need with an innovative solution to an ongoing problem in the fashion world — what to do with excess inventory.

246. The Kiva.org Story + Leveraging the Power of Crowdfunding - Chris Tsakalakis
Meet Chris. This CEO and son of a journeyman is taking what he learned in for-profit finance to nonprofit's most progressive microfinancing loan organization - Kiva - and the story is truly fascinating. Hear Kiva's mission story and understand this brilliant business model of this nonprofit that's powering its movement through crowdfunds loans benefitting underserved people in more than 70 countries.

195. Democratizing the Donor Advised Fund to Grow Philanthropy for All - John Bromley
Meet John. He's tired of seeing donor advised funds sitting around unspent. He's democratized the DAF world, and he wants you and your kids to be an active part of the giving community. You see, once he recognized a need to make giving more accessible and more effective, he launched Charitable Impact which nurtures generosity within each person and bring resources for creating change in the world to everyone. In short, it's a super cool giving platform that makes even a $5 feel like a serious investment in philanthropy. Together, we're talking basics (what the heck is a donor advised fund?) but also talking about how to make our personal philanthropy intentional rather than reactive.
